Hotel Plaza Colón occupies a restored colonial mansion on the north side of Granada's Central Park, facing the Cathedral of Granada directly across the square. The position is the most prominent address in the city — the hotel's terrace looks directly onto the park's manicured gardens, horse-drawn carriages, and the cathedral's ochre facade, making it simultaneously a landmark address and the best vantage point in Granada for watching the city's daily rhythms.
The building dates to the colonial period and has been restored to preserve its original proportions: high ceilings, wide arched galleries running the full length of the facade, and a central courtyard that interior rooms and suites look onto. The courtyard holds a pool framed by palms and potted plants. Public areas include a formal lounge, a library corner, and a covered terrace on the park side where breakfast is served and afternoon drinks draw both hotel guests and a small number of local business visitors.
Rooms and suites are furnished with period-appropriate reproduction furniture, four-poster beds in the larger categories, and pressed cotton linens. Floors are original tile or polished concrete. Air conditioning, WiFi, and modern bathrooms are standard throughout. Superior rooms and suites face either the park or the interior courtyard; standard rooms are interior-facing with less natural light.
The restaurant operates throughout the day and into the evening, serving Nicaraguan and international dishes. The wine list is the most comprehensive of any hotel in Granada. Most rate categories include breakfast, served on the covered park terrace. The concierge team can arrange private boat tours of Las Isletas, day trips to Masaya Volcano and Mombacho, and transport connections to Managua airport. The hotel targets independent luxury travellers, couples, and business visitors seeking a character property with genuine historical context.

Tips for visiting
- Reserve a park-facing superior room or suite for the cathedral view — standard rooms face the interior and cost less but sacrifice the signature outlook.
- The covered park terrace is the best public vantage point in Granada for watching the evening paseo, when locals gather in the park from around 6pm.
- Ask the concierge about private panga arrangements for Las Isletas — these offer more flexibility and quieter tours than the group departures from the public dock.
- Granada's peak periods (Christmas, New Year, Semana Santa) require booking three or more months ahead for this property.
- Valet parking can be arranged for guests arriving by private vehicle — request it at the time of reservation.
When to visit
November through April (dry season) is optimal. The Central Park directly opposite the hotel is at its most animated on dry-season evenings when temperatures are comfortable and the paseo is active.
Accessibility
The hotel is in a multi-storey colonial building with stairs and no lift. Guests with mobility limitations should contact the hotel before booking to enquire about ground-floor room options facing the interior courtyard.
